Did this trial in a stock gen1 nissan xterra with cooper discoverer at tires, no modifications at all. About the trial, it was just simple that any sedan can be driven at first and eventually changes its behaviour. We went in the first week of june where didn’t had rain in past couple of weeks. It was about 22 degrees, and less humid. We got one water crossing reaching to the rocker panels of the truck and scared to take it in the water because we didn’t knew how deep it was. And overall it was a great experience and for a beginner it’s not something challenging. And roam around there are a lot of trials and have some kind of crownland maps with you. Because you can camp and stay in those places and there are alot.
